A multi-country project involving a range of interdisciplinary groups, artists, health professionals and people in long term recovery.  The Arts Social Change Project spans four countries France, Italy, Lithuania and the UK.

 

Focusing on the use of art and social interaction in facilitating recovery change, the project contributes to the development of a innovative training programme to strengthen transversal competencies of health staff working with people in recovery from addictions.

The Personal Recovery Conceptual framework (CHIME) Leamy et al (2010) ( that has been conducted at the Institute of Mental Health) provides the theoretical framework underlying the project.

Dr Theo Stickley is currently evaluating this project.
